How to fill out the Blackboard Test Creation and Import Instructions?
1
Open Microsoft Word and create your test questions following the formatting rules.
2
Copy the formatted questions after saving the document.
3
Paste the questions into the Test Generator on the specified website.
4
Download the prepared .txt file containing your test questions.
5
Upload the .txt file into your Blackboard course.
